The character quality of the week is Discern. This is a big word, some of you may not have ever heard of or used! To discern means to be able to know and understand why things happen to you and to others; to be insightful. It is recognizing the "how" and "why" in situations. Why did they get their best time? How did they get an A on the test? Why are they so kind? When you ask "how" and "why", you understand the deeper meaning of being a great character (i.e. making good decisions, overcoming pain, being noble, trusting, doing hard work, being obedient, and loving one another, etc...). Be aware of the good and the right you do in your life and why it is the good and the right and then keep acting on it!
"You must first understand something or someone before you can commit to it or them. Little or no understanding means shallow commitment and little cost." - Wade Salem
